Welcome to the Spindry locker crew! Quick context for your first review: the access flow issues a one-time code when a customer drops off laundry, then a fresh code when the Driftmoor facility marks the order ready. Codes expire after 15 minutes, and the door controller checks them against the grants table — watch for PRs that skip the expiry check, it's a recurring mistake. To poke at the flow locally, the grants service connects using the connection string below.

replica DSN, kajep-yahag: mssql://praok_svc:iF@db-8d68.plorvaio.local:5432/eliion

**Mgmt Meeting Minutes — Retiring the Brightline Range**

Quick recap for sales leads at Fenholt Supplies: we agreed to retire the Brightline fixture range by year-end. Remaining stock moves to clearance pricing next month, and accounts on standing orders get migrated to the Lumetta range. Trade-in incentives were approved in principle. The confidential note on next steps sits just below.

board note of bajof-bajeg: The pricing group signed off on a budget of $13.4 million for Project Sildor. The renewal with Lamixek Holdings closes at $48.9 million a year, 49 percent above the last contract.

- [ ] **Step 7: Breaker override escrow.** After sealing the signing keys for the Tallgrove upstream API circuit breaker, confirm the support team can force the breaker open during a full outage. The override bundle lives in the sealed escrow drawer and is useless without its unlock phrase. Two ceremony witnesses must initial this step before proceeding. The escrow bundle is decrypted with the recovery passphrase that follows.

vault phrase of kahip-kahop = holath-quenmir

Ticket: Staging env misconfigured for Siftgate bloom filter

The bloom layer in front of the Pellet KV store is rejecting all lookups in staging because the env file was copied from the dev template without credentials. False-positive tuning values are fine; only the auth line is missing. To unblock the weekly demo, the Pellet admission secret must be set on the following line.

env line for yaguf-fajop: LEDGER_TOKEN13=fb08984397349